Hamburg Sea Devils sign ELF playmaker Terryon Robinson

This offseason, the Hamburg Sea Devils surprised their fans and the European League of Football with some splash moves. In addition to Head Coach Shuan Fatah, the team from the North Division signed three-time Defensive Player of the Year Kyle Kitchens.

Now the Hamburgers are bringing an old friend of their new defensive star into the team. Wide receiver Terryon Robinson signed a one-year deal with the Sea Devils. The US import and Kitchens know each other from their younger years together in the States. The two attended fourth grade together. 

Stud at Western Carolina University

They later played together at Decatur High School. “He's like a brother,” Robinson says about Kitchens. After his time in high school, Robinson transferred to Western Carolina University (NCAA D1). Here, the wideout performed fantastically, making him the school's all-time leading receiver.

Robinson finished his college career with 230 receptions, 2,839 receiving yards and 19 touchdowns. Performances that he was able to build on in the European League of Football. 

Reliable ELF starter

The now 30-year-old made his ELF debut in 2022 for the Istanbul Rams. This was followed by a year with the Cologne Centurions and another with the Helvetic Mercenaries. In total, the US receiver made 20 ELF games, completing all of them as a starter. He caught 122 passes for 1731 yards and 20 touchdowns. 

Robinson is looking forward to the new challenge: “ Extremely excited to join one of the best cultures and fan bases in the ELF. Looking forward to starting the journey of re-establishing the Sea Devils as a force moving forward. Ready to show what it means to be QB Friendly!”
